The Harvey Warner Manitoba Mile Stakes headlines the card at Assiniboia Downs on Monday, August 5, 2025, as Race 5, offering a $65,000 purse for three-year-olds and up over 1 mile on dirt. This stakes race honors Manitoba racing legend Harvey Warner and features a deep field of seasoned runners, elite trainers, and top jockeys.
